sb600spi.c: Use SPI100 bit mappings
On AMD SoCs that use SPI100 engine, flashrom has been using legacy spi100 register and bit mappings when programming the engine - specifically when programming the opcode and triggering their execution. --------------------------------------------------------------------- | Register Name | Legacy SPI100 mapping | Updated SPI100 mapping | |---------------|------------------------|--------------------------| | Opcode | Offset 0 from SPI BAR | Offset 0x45 from SPI BAR | | | Bits 0:7 | Bits 0:7 | |---------------|------------------------|--------------------------| | Execute Cmd | Offset 2 from SPI BAR | Offset 0x47 from SPI BAR | | | Bit 1 | Bit 7 | --------------------------------------------------------------------- These legacy register mappings are removed in upcoming generations of AMD SoCs. Stop using the legacy spi100 registers. For more details about SPI100 refer to document: 56569-A1 Rev 3.01 BUG=b:228238107 TEST=Build and deploy flashrom in Skyrim. Ensure that flashrom is able to detect the SPI ROM chip, read from it and write to it successfully. Ran flashrom_tester on Dewatt (Cezanne SoC), Dalboz (Picasso SoC) successfully and ensured that all the tests passed.
